Summary
Overview
Work History
Education
Skills
Certification
Websites
Additional Information
Accomplishments
Timeline
Generic

Mohit Mangal

Summary

Lead Database Engineer with 15+ years of experience, specializing in Oracle SQL and PL/SQL, covering database design, development, and optimization. Skilled in adapting to new technologies, recently leading enterprise data migration from Oracle to MongoDB using MongoDB Relational Migrator, Compass, and Atlas. Experienced in designing NoSQL schemas, building aggregation pipelines, and managing secure developer access.

Strong leadership and mentoring abilities, fostering continuous learning within teams. Believes that technical interviews are just one aspect of evaluating a candidate’s potential, and that not clearing them sometimes does not fully reflect true capabilities. Committed to ongoing learning and leveraging emerging technologies to drive organizational growth.

Overview

18
18
years of professional experience
1
1
Certification

Work History

Consultant

GlobalLogic
Pune
05.2024 - Current

Project: Dollar General.

  • Dollar General is a major retail chain in the U.S. Undergoing a digital transformation by moving its legacy, monolithic systems to modern, cloud-based infrastructure. As part of this initiative, the focus was on migrating key business modules, like Coupons and Cashback, from Oracle databases to MongoDB to improve scalability, performance, and data agility.

Duties Include:

  • Contributed to the migration of legacy data from Oracle to MongoDB using the MongoDB Relational Migrator, ensuring data consistency and integrity.
  • Designed and managed MongoDB databases, collections, and indexes to support the new microservices-based architecture.
  • Developed aggregation pipelines using MongoDB operators such as $set and $merge for efficient post-migration data transformation.
  • Assisted in optimizing SQL queries and translating legacy schemas to NoSQL models for application compatibility.
  • Interacted directly with the DB client to manage developer access needs, including provisioning credentials, and resolving permission issues to unblock development teams.
  • Managed environment isolation and access control, ensuring secure and structured access during different phases of development and deployment.

Senior Technical Lead

Infovision
Pune
04.2023 - 04.2024

Project: Staples – Warehouse Management System (WMS) & Product Development POC.

  • Contributed to enhancing Staples’ data infrastructure by migrating legacy systems to Snowflake, supporting both online and retail operations. I reverse-engineered Python scripts using Pandas and translated them into Snowflake for improved performance and scalability. Played an active role in the SQL to Snowflake migration, ensuring business continuity throughout the transition. Followed Agile methodology and managed tasks through Jira. Delivered data-driven insights using Power BI dashboards for better reporting.
  • Additionally, I led a Proof of Concept (POC) initiative to guide future product development. Mentored junior team members to strengthen coding practices, and collaborated on database development using Oracle PL/SQL and stored procedures.

Technical Lead

Fulcrum Digital
Pune
12.2021 - 03.2023

Project: Vocalink Pay by Bank App (PbBa):

  • I played a pivotal role in the development and successful delivery of this innovative solution that integrates mobile banking into online shopping. This project revolutionized the consumer buying experience by providing a seamless and secure payment method directly from the user's bank account, placing mobile banking at the forefront of online transactions. My responsibilities spanned across various aspects of the project, including providing technical leadership to teammates through coaching and mentorship, gaining hands-on experience with Oracle PL/SQL and stored procedures, and using agile methodology to plan and track projects using the JIRA/ALM tool. I showcased proficiency with SVN and GIT for version control, actively participated in deployment activities using Bitbucket and Jenkins, and utilized SonarQube to analyze and improve code quality. I also configured Flyway to create databases and handle version migrations for specific project requirements.

Tech Lead

Tech Mahindra
Pune
09.2019 - 12.2021

Project: Scorecard Engine.

  • A system designed to compute LTE RTB scorecards. This innovative project involved selecting data from raw PM interface tables and inserting it into aggregate tables at hourly, daily, and weekly intervals. Scorecard Engine, while primarily used for scorecard data, is a general-purpose SQL execution engine compatible with any JDBC 7-supported database, including Oracle, Vertica, Teradata, MS-SQL, and Postgres. My role encompassed a wide range of responsibilities, including daily job monitoring, attending operation and client calls, managing Irack tickets within given timelines, handling code changes and deployments, and participating in the migration from Vertica to Snowflake. I also managed and mentored team members, fostering a collaborative and productive work environment. My leadership skills were demonstrated through effective communication, problem-solving, technical expertise, and client management. This experience has equipped me with a diverse skill set and a comprehensive understanding of project management in a technical environment.

Technical Lead

InfoVisionLabs
Pune
05.2019 - 09.2019

Project: Avaya Enterprise Solution Development.

  • I was instrumental in the development of a new store for the EMEA location. This project, related to Store Front, involved the flow of quote creation, promotion, adding to cart, and processing for users who might be sellers or distributors falling under Tier 1 or Tier 1 N2. My responsibilities were multifaceted and included understanding business requirements for change, conducting impact analysis of functional changes required in existing systems, and interacting with clients on change-related matters. I was hands-on with PL/SQL's various kinds of objects, developing requirements, and testing them. I was available with the client during deployment and looked into defects in production. As Tech Lead, I also led and mentored team members, fostering a collaborative and productive work environment.

Technical Lead

Attra Infotech Pvt Ltd
Pune
10.2018 - 05.2019

Project: Team formation and support to the team technically.

  • During this period, I was not assigned to a specific project due to the organization's focus on recruiting more relevant candidates. However, this time was productively utilized in several key areas. I was involved in a PoC with the team, providing technical support and sharing my expertise. This allowed me to contribute to the team's learning and growth, and also helped in validating new ideas and solutions. Additionally, I served as a panelist in technical drives aimed at team formation. This role enabled me to leverage my technical knowledge and understanding of the team's needs to help identify and onboard suitable candidates. This experience has further honed my technical and leadership skills, preparing me for future challenges in a dynamic work environment.

Team Lead

Tech Mahindra
Pune
03.2016 - 10.2018

Project 1: DTI.

  • I was involved in designing and developing solutions for receiving batch and near real-time data feeds from a variety of data sources. The goal was to provide real-time, low latency, high-quality, transformed, and integrated data to the data fabric layers of the enterprise. My responsibilities included understanding business requirements for change, conducting impact analysis of functional changes, developing new and modifying existing components, and handling unit test cases and testing. I was also involved in QC deployment, release coordination, and production implementation activities. As a leader, I guided my team through these processes, fostering a collaborative environment, and ensuring successful project delivery.

Project 2: K2view Migration

  • I played a significant role in migrating key services APIs of the CCR database to the K2view platform. This project involved transforming CCR stored procedures into web services and microservices, which were tightly integrated into the CDP platform of AT&T. The data was organized by logical units of business, with each logical instance treated as a micro-database. Data was migrated from the Oracle database to the Distributed Database (Cassandra) using various parsers and scheduled jobs. My responsibilities included understanding business requirements for change, conducting impact analysis of functional changes, developing microservices and web services in the K2fabric studio tool, and deploying on the Cassandra server. I was also responsible for loading data into Cassandra, creating DB templates, and Graphite to display responses, handling unit test cases, comparator tool testing, XSD comparison, and looking into defects during QC deployment. As Tech Lead, I led and mentored team members, fostering a collaborative and productive work environment.

Sr. Software Consultant

Ventura India Pvt. Ltd. (Capita)
Pune
07.2014 - 03.2016

Project: Dialer

  • As a key contributor to the Dialler project at Capita (Ventura), a UK-based BPO and product company, I worked on the development and support of the Dialler and Aida products. The project involved providing services to Capita's clients in the UK, SA, and other regions. I was introduced to a new tool, 'Syntelate', used for campaigns, which enables agents to call their customers and provide relevant customer details. My responsibilities included analyzing change control provided in Lotus Notes, providing impact analysis, making changes to code or creating scripts, and coding in SQL/PL/SQL. I also provided changes to the DBA in the UK for execution in production. In addition to these responsibilities, I took on the role of grooming junior resources, sharing product knowledge, and cultivating a collaborative learning environment.

System Analyst

Rsystems International Ltd
Pune
12.2010 - 07.2014

Project 1: E-Stores (Dec 2010 - Aug 2013):

  • In this supply chain management and business-to-business project, I worked on e-stores for order processing. My responsibilities included analyzing clients' requirements, implementing PLSQL blocks, procedures, and functions, coding, testing, and application support.

Project 2: Kotak (Loan Origination System) (Aug 2013 - Sep 2013):

  • I worked on a web-based application used for loan origination. My role involved application enhancements and support activities, implementing, designing, and developing PLSQL blocks, procedures, and functions, as well as coding and testing.

Project 3: GE Money Bank (Oct 2013 - Jan 2014):

  • In this project, I was involved in generating reports for GE's various business lines. My responsibilities included analyzing given matrix sheets, understanding French terms related to the database, reporting to the reporting manager for related issues in the mapping sheet, coding in SQL, and preparing technical specifications.

Project 4: Tata Motor Finance (Collection) (Jan 2014 - Jul 2014):

  • As a System Analyst, I worked on a project for Tata Motor Finance, focusing on auto loan delinquent accounts. My role involved analyzing functional specifications, coding in SQL/PLSQL, developing CSV reports in the Comq framework, and resolving PA issues.

Contractor

CMC LTD
Mumbai
01.2008 - 07.2009

Project: IRS (Integrated Reporting System)

  • I was involved in generating daily, weekly, and monthly regulatory reports for RBI reporting. The system was used to support end users from both the Finance and Operations teams for regulatory purposes. My role was to provide satisfactory onsite support, make necessary modifications or changes in the system and reports, and develop new features as advised by users. My responsibilities included writing stored procedures and SQL queries, updating and modifying old SQL queries based on user requests, and updating and modifying Crystal Reports as per user requirements. I also utilized PL/SQL code, in addition to SQL, for complex database operations, enhancing the functionality and efficiency of the system.

Education

Masters - Computer Application

Dr. Bhim Rao Ambedkar University
Agra, U.P.

Skills

Primary skills

  • Databases: Oracle SQL, PL/SQL (procedures, functions, packages, triggers, collections); MongoDB (databases, collections, indexes, validation, aggregation pipelines using $set, $merge)
  • Database tools: PLSQL Developer, Toad, SQL Developer, DB Visualizer
  • Cloud-based tools: MongoDB Compass, MongoDB Relational Migrator, MongoDB Atlas

Secondary skills

  • Cloud data warehousing: Snowflake
  • Data Fabric and Virtualization: K2View Fabric Studio
  • Data integration and streaming: Oracle GoldenGate, Apache NiFi
  • Scripting and operating systems: Unix shell scripting
  • Version control and CI/CD: Git, PVCS, SVN (Tortoise), SonarQube
  • Project management and collaboration: Jira, PuTTY

Least used skills

  • Programming/scripting: Python (Pandas)
  • Databases: Vertica, Cassandra, PostgreSQL
  • ETL/BI tools: IBM DataStage 75, Crystal Reports, Oracle Forms/Reports 6i
  • Other tools: Mobxtreme, Oracle Forms/Reports Builder 6i

Certification

  • SI Associate Certification (MongoDB) - 07/15/24
  • Proof of completion (MongoDB) - 07/15/24
  • Hands-on Essentials (Snowflake) - Data Warehouse, 05/17/21
  • Oracle 10g (SQL/PLSQL) certified course, 02/2010 - 04/2010
  • Certification in Systems Support Engineering Program: System Integration, 10/2007 - 01/2008

Additional Information

  • Attained 'Hands-On Essentials (Snowflake) - Data Warehouse' certification on May 17, 2021
  • Completed the Oracle10g (SQL/PLSQL) certified course from SQLSTAR during February 2010 – April 2010
  • Achieved certification in the Systems Support Engineering Program: System Integration from CMC Limited, Oct 2007 - Jan 2008
  • Onsite professional summary: Successfully executed a 2-month onsite assignment in the UK while working with Capita India Pvt Ltd, and received training on the Syntelate tool used for campaign management

Accomplishments

  • Victor Of the Week - August 2024

Timeline

Consultant

GlobalLogic
05.2024 - Current

Senior Technical Lead

Infovision
04.2023 - 04.2024

Technical Lead

Fulcrum Digital
12.2021 - 03.2023

Tech Lead

Tech Mahindra
09.2019 - 12.2021

Technical Lead

InfoVisionLabs
05.2019 - 09.2019

Technical Lead

Attra Infotech Pvt Ltd
10.2018 - 05.2019

Team Lead

Tech Mahindra
03.2016 - 10.2018

Sr. Software Consultant

Ventura India Pvt. Ltd. (Capita)
07.2014 - 03.2016

System Analyst

Rsystems International Ltd
12.2010 - 07.2014

Contractor

CMC LTD
01.2008 - 07.2009

Masters - Computer Application

Dr. Bhim Rao Ambedkar University
Mohit Mangal